in reply to (OT) DBD error Ora-12154

Well, that means that Oracle couldn't connect to the name you gave it . . . doesn't get much simpler than that. You need to consult with your DBA and or sysadmin and make sure that "CDWP02" is the right database name (I think "sid" in Oracle parlance) to be using.
